This genus is also known to affect birds, causing avian malaria. Plasmodium usually infects the red blood cells in humans and other mammals. Four plasmodium species (plasmodium falciparum, plasmodium vivax, plasmodium ovale and plasmodium malariae) give disease in humans, and humans are their only relevant reservoir.

Plasmodium, Which Infects Red Blood Cells In Mammals (Including Humans), Birds, And Reptiles, Occurs Worldwide, Especially In Tropical And Temperate Zones.
